Golf Fan Travel Tips
Ballot vs General Sale vs Resale
The Masters: ballot for practice rounds (free application). The Open: general sale via R&A — buy day tickets are released each morning. Ryder Cup: ballot 12–18 months out. Secondary market exists for all Majors but prices are premium at Augusta and Ryder Cup.
Practice rounds vs tournament days
Practice rounds let you walk the course freely and see players up close on the range and fairways. Tournament days have roped gallery routes. For Augusta, practice rounds are often the most memorable — access to Amen Corner and Eisenhower's Cabin. The Open's links courses offer walking freedom tournament fans love.
Getting to remote venues
The Open at Royal Portrush: fly into Belfast (BFS or BHD) and drive 1 hour north. Augusta: fly into Atlanta (ATL) and drive 2 hours — rent a car as local taxis run out fast. Bethpage Black: from NYC, take the LIRR train to Farmingdale or Bethpage, then walk. Build in flexibility for traffic on tournament days.
Accommodation strategy
Augusta has limited hotels — book 12 months out or consider Columbia, SC (1h) or Atlanta (2h). Royal Portrush: Belfast hotels + day trips by car, or coastal B&Bs near Portrush. Bethpage: NYC hotels + LIRR train. Charlotte and Pittsburgh have plentiful downtown hotels within 30–45 min of course.

Golf Travel — FAQ
How do you get tickets for The Masters at Augusta National?
Masters practice round tickets are available via a lottery system — applications open each spring on masters.com. Tournament round (competition days) patron badges are extremely limited and are mainly held by badge holders who have attended for decades. A small number of practice round tickets are available. For tournament rounds, the secondary market is the main option, though prices are very high. Practice round tickets offer full course access and are often described as the best value in golf.
What makes the Ryder Cup special as a fan travel event?
The Ryder Cup is the most team-oriented event in golf — fans split between USA and Europe in a partisan atmosphere more like football than golf. It is held every two years, alternating between US and European venues. The 2026 edition at Bethpage Black, New York, will bring a home crowd atmosphere. Tickets are available via the official Ryder Cup ballot. The event is a long-weekend trip — many fans attend practice rounds to get closer to players.
Which golf Major is easiest to attend as a fan?
The Open Championship (The Open) is widely regarded as the most accessible Major for international fans. Tickets are available via the R&A website and daily sale. The Open is held at historic links courses around the UK and Ireland, with a unique festival atmosphere — camping, marquees, and a full fan village. 2026 is at Royal Portrush in Northern Ireland. The US Open and PGA Championship also have publicly available tickets through their respective associations.
When is the best time to book for a golf Major trip?
For The Masters, apply for the ticket ballot in spring (as soon as applications open). For The Open, tickets go on general sale several months before the event — buy as soon as they open. For the Ryder Cup, the ballot runs 12–18 months before the event. Book accommodation 6–12 months in advance for all Majors — nearby hotels fill up fast, especially for The Masters in Augusta (a small city) and The Open at links venues in smaller towns.
